The catalog separates Gold Coins (play-only credits) from Sweeps Coins (the redeemable currency), and most games accept Sweeps Coins so you can build toward cashable wins while enjoying the same core gameplay.

Promotions and bonuses that actually add value

Chumba’s promotions center on Sweeps Coins, which are the pathway to real prizes. New accounts typically receive an automatic welcome credit (Gold Coins plus a small Sweeps Coin allocation), and the $10 purchase bundles a large Gold Coin package with extra Sweeps Coins — that’s where the real payout potential begins. Daily login rewards stack over the week and there’s a mail-in method to claim Sweeps Coins if you prefer a no-cost route; that postal option takes longer but is a nice alternative.

Important detail: Sweeps Coins carry a low 1x playthrough requirement before you can request redemption, and all eligible games count 100% toward that playthrough. Sweeps redemptions require a minimum of 100 Sweeps Coins and are subject to verification and standard redemption limits. Gold Coins are strictly for play and can’t be cashed out. Deposits, withdrawals, and how fast you’ll see money

Chumba accepts common payment methods (ACH, American Express, MasterCard, PaySafeCard, Skrill) and operates in USD only. Purchases generally process quickly so you can jump into games without delay. When it’s time to redeem Sweeps Coin winnings you’ll need to pass identity verification — expect to provide photo ID and proof of address — and processing times depend on the payout method. For example, Skrill payouts can handle larger same-day amounts (with daily caps; some methods list up to $5,000 per day), while bank transfers take longer and may have additional checks.

A few practical notes: Sweeps Coins cannot be bought directly outside of approved packages and mail-in credits; there’s a single-account policy per household and inactivity can cause Sweeps Coins to expire after a set period. Safety, rules, and the sweepstakes model

Chumba operates under the sweepstakes coin model, which separates promotional Gold Coins from redeemable Sweeps Coins and is designed to comply with U.S. eligibility rules in supported states (available in 43 states; restricted in Washington, Idaho, Michigan, Nevada, and New York). Players must be 21+ and adhere to one account per household. Expect standard account verification and anti-fraud screening before large redemptions are approved.

On the security front, the site uses common encryption and verification practices; you’ll be asked to upload ID and address documentation for withdrawals. Promotions have clear playthrough rules (most notably the 1x requirement on Sweeps Coins) and a few important limits — unplayed Sweeps Coins can expire after a period of inactivity, and bonus abuse risks account action.

Player FAQs: practical answers from someone who plays

Can I turn Gold Coins into real money?

No — Gold Coins are just for play. Only Sweeps Coins can be redeemed for prizes and cash once you meet the minimum redemption requirements.

How do I get Sweeps Coins without spending?

Besides purchase bundles, you can claim automatic welcome Sweeps, daily login awards, or submit a mail-in request (postcard/letter with the code provided on-site). Mail-in requests take up to about 10 business days for processing.

What’s the one playthrough rule mean in plain language?

It means you must wager Sweeps Coins in games an amount equal to their value one time before you can request redemption. Most games contribute 100% to that requirement, so you won’t be forced into awkward game restrictions.

I live in a restricted state — is there any workaround?

No. State restrictions are enforced by eligibility checks and address verification. Trying to bypass them can lead to account closure and forfeiture.

How long does verification take for a payout?

It depends on how quickly you upload clear ID and address documents. Once all documents are submitted, processing times vary by payout method — budget several business days to a couple of weeks for bank transfers.
